A Case Study: From Diesel Forklifts to Smart AGVs in Germany
Last year, we partnered with a mid-sized automotive parts manufacturer in Bavaria. Struggling with rising diesel costs and tightening EU emissions regulations (including CE certification requirements), they transitioned to lithium-powered AGVs and AI-driven scheduling systems. The result? 24/7 unmanned operations and a 40% reduction in energy consumption—proving sustainability and efficiency can coexist.
Sustainability Compliance: Europe’s Non-Negotiable
European clients prioritise environmental accountability like nowhere else:
Electric forklifts now dominate 60% of sales (per FEM Europe data), with Nordic clients insisting on ERP energy-classified equipment.
For a Dutch logistics firm, we delivered hydrogen fuel cell-powered handling equipment, aligning with the Netherlands’ “Zero-Emission Warehousing by 2030” mandate.
